Parks technologist
City of Brantford’s Parks And Recreation Department is inviting applications from suitable candidates for the position of Parks technologist. City of Brantford’s Parks and Recreation Department enhances community well-being by managing parks, trails, and recreational facilities. It provides diverse programs, including sports, fitness, and leisure activities, to promote active lifestyles. Requirements:
Languages: Candidates must have knowledge of the English Language
Education:Â Candidates should have completion of a 3-year diploma in a landscape or technology program Architectural Technology, Civil Engineering Technology and Landscape Design
Experience: Candidates should have a minimum of three years of progressive experience
Physical Requirements:
- The candidates should have demonstrated project management skills, organizational skills, attention to detail, analytical and problem-solving skills, the capability to provide guidance on procedures, and the ability to work independently
- The candidates should have a technical understanding of the planning, design, and construction of sports fields, trails, parks, and playgrounds
- The candidates should have highly developed written and verbal communication skills and presentation skills
Other Requirements:
- The candidates should be proficient in the use of ArcGIS and GIS applications for the upkeep and development of inventory databases and mapping
- The candidates should be proficient in the use of AutoCAD, be skilled with computer applications, including MS Word, Excel, and Outlook
- The candidates should have an OACETT designation, a PMP designation, skills in Cartegraph
- The candidates should have a valid G-class driver’s license with access to a personal vehicle
Responsibilities:
- The candidates should be able to coordinate parks operational maintenance contracts and manage data within the parks operations teams
- The candidates should be able to lead the development of standard operating procedure and coordinate the implementation and maintenance of Cartegraph
- The candidates should be able to review site plans and engineering drawings to assess operating impacts and provide recommendations
- The candidates should be able to oversee and execute minor capital projects and annual service contracts for parks and trails operations
- The candidates should be able to monitor and inspect operational projects and contracts and review operating costs and develop estimates
- The candidates should be able to maintain trail counters, analyze data, and manage inventories of park
- The candidates should be able to provide technical expertise on a wide range of park-related projects
